Clinical Social Worker (LSW) Remote | Michigan Job Description Mind Health Group is a growing, patient-centered psychiatric and mental health practice dedicated to providing compassionate, high-quality care through telehealth. We work collaboratively across psychiatry and therapy to support patients through every stage of life. Our mission is to make mental health care accessible, holistic, and deeply human.
Our Divisions of Care include:
Mood & Anxiety Disorders Postpartum Mental Health Care Senior Cognitive & Mental Health Care Substance Use & Dual Diagnosis Position Overview We are seeking a Clinical Social Worker (LSW) licensed in the state of Michigan who is passionate about mental health and excited to join a collaborative psychiatric practice. This clinician will provide talk therapy services via telehealth, working closely with psychiatric providers and care teams to deliver integrated, patient-centered treatment. This role is ideal for a clinician who values flexibility, teamwork, and making a meaningful impact from anywhere. Key Responsibilities Provide individual psychotherapy services via telehealth Assess, diagnose, and treat patients with mental health conditions including anxiety, depression, postpartum mood disorders, and age-related mental health concerns Develop and implement individualized treatment plans Maintain timely and accurate clinical documentation Collaborate with psychiatric providers for coordinated care Uphold ethical, legal, and professional standards of practice Participate in team meetings, case consultations, and ongoing collaboration Qualifications Active LSW license in the state of Michigan (required) Experience providing therapy for: Anxiety and mood disorders Postpartum mental health Adult and/or senior populations Strong clinical, communication, and organizational skills Comfortable working in a fully remote / telehealth environment Experience with EMRs and virtual platforms preferred Passion for compassionate, patient-centered mental health care Ability to work independently while thriving in a team-based setting What We Offer 100% remote position - work from home Flexible scheduling (full-time or part-time options) Supportive, collaborative team of psychiatric providers Steady referrals from an established psychiatric practice Administrative and operational support Meaningful work serving diverse patient populationsJob Types:
